Document Transport — Drone Returns. The Corvix-7 unit returned from the Hallowmere route is tagged for servicing at Ostrel Aeroworks. Dispatch should log the airframe hours, remove the battery pack, and seal both in the padded transit case. Ostrel's courier collects from bay 2 on Wednesdays. Hand the case over only once the courier gives this phrase:

dispatch memo: the sorox briiel courier leaves the druius kelion fenir gorvan ralael rusius julwyn belwyn ledger at gate 4220 under passcode 637242

Handover note — Mira to Dalen

Finance folks, quick context as I pass the Lumabox launch to Dalen: budget is locked through Q3, media spend front-loaded into the Harwick market pilot, and the contingency sits untouched. Dalen will confirm final unit pricing next week. One item stays off the general deck — see below.

board note of bawep-tajef: Queniusek Systems plans to raise the Quenvan list price by 53.1 percent in March. The pricing group signed off on a budget of $176.4 million for Project Drueth. The renewal with Casionix Partners closes at $142.5 million a year, 8.3 percent below the last contract. Project Fraax slips by six weeks because of the tooling delay.

## v2.9.0 — Idempotency keys for payment retries

Payment retries in Ledgerline now require a client-supplied idempotency key, stored for 48 hours and scoped per merchant account. Duplicate submissions with the same key return the original response instead of re-charging — so the double-billing class of bugs from the Q2 incident is gone. Keys are hashed at rest and never logged in plaintext. Security folks: replay-window tuning is documented in the internal spec. Any concerns should be routed to the owner named below.

named custodian: Brivan Eliath Quenox Frador

# Break-Glass: Catalog Cache Invalidation

Scope: the Pinrow product catalog at Veldstone Retail. If stale prices persist after a purge and the Hollowmere invalidation queue is wedged, use break-glass to flush the edge tier directly. Contractors: get verbal sign-off from the catalog lead first. Steps: open the Hollowmere admin shell, select emergency-flush, confirm the tenant, and run it once — repeated flushes thrash the origin. Access is logged and expires after 20 minutes. Unseal the admin shell with the passphrase below.

recovery phrase for kahop-tajog: istix-casvan